我正在使用Silverlight for Windows Phone Toolkit中的LongListSelector。
对于每个组,我想在组头中显示一个与小组相关的图标。
A组 第1项 第2项 第3项
每个项目都具有相同的密钥,并且正确分组。每个项目都有相同的图像。但是当我将GroupHeaderTemplate从键更改为其他内容时。它似乎没有正确处理。
答案 0 :(得分:2)
通常,您会看到使用“Group”对象的示例,该对象基于实现IEnumberable的IGrouping<TKey, T>
样式对象,并且具有单个Key属性。
但是,没有理由为什么你的组对象也不能拥有一系列其他属性,如“Name”和“ImageSource”,无论你能在组项模板中绑定什么。
答案 1 :(得分:0)
看看这两篇文章,了解LongListSelector
答案 2 :(得分:0)
您能否向我们展示一些有关您的源数据和您正在使用的XAMl的更多信息。听起来你需要为每个组公开你想要的图像的路径,然后将GroupHeaderTemplate中的Image元素绑定到该属性。